Transparent Pricing Model
With man and van Shoreditch pricing, the starting point is a simple, honest structure. Instead of vague estimates, the cost is based on measurable factors such as load size, number of items, whether furniture needs dismantling, and how easy it is to park and load. This is especially useful in Shoreditch, where a job on a narrow street off Curtain Road may take longer than a straightforward collection from a building with lift access.
What the price usually includes
A typical quote can include vehicle hire, a professional driver, loading support, fuel within the agreed route, and basic handling of your items. If the move involves extra labour, multiple stops, or awkward access, those details are shown in advance. This approach keeps the Man And A Van Shoreditch service easy to budget for, whether you are relocating a home office from a modern apartment or shifting stock from a small creative workspace.
Load-based pricing is one of the most straightforward ways to calculate a move in Shoreditch. It works well for customers who have a mix of furniture, boxes, and personal items, because the quote reflects how much of the van is required. For example, a single-room move from a converted warehouse flat may only need a partial load, while a packed two-bedroom apartment near Liverpool Street may require a much larger vehicle allocation.
For smaller jobs, cubic-yard rates offer another transparent option. This method is useful when you want to estimate the volume of your belongings rather than count individual items. It is particularly practical for residents in compact flats, mezzanine apartments, or shared houses where space is tight but belongings are neatly packed. A few cubic yards may cover suitcases, boxes, and a desk chair, while larger volumes can be used for sofas, shelving, and boxed kitchenware.
